Chairman Jeon Seungil of Gwangju Seo-gu Council Receives 'Plaque of Appreciation' from Gwangju Small Business Association

Recognized for Contributions to Revitalizing the Regional Economy

On December 31, Jeon Seungil, Chairman of the Gwangju Seo-gu Council, announced that he had received a plaque of appreciation from the Gwangju Metropolitan City Small Business Association in recognition of his contributions to the development of local small business owners and the revitalization of the regional economy.

This plaque of appreciation was awarded by the Small Business Association to express gratitude for Chairman Jeon Seungil's dedicated efforts to enhance the rights and interests of local small business owners and improve their business environment, as well as for his policy attention and practical actions to strengthen the self-reliance of small businesses and establish a sustainable foundation for the regional economy.


Chairman Jeon Seungil has consistently shown interest in the changes and challenges facing local commercial districts and has worked to establish institutional support and improve business conditions for small business owners.


In particular, even amid complex economic conditions such as the economic downturn and rising prices, he has focused on developing practical support measures by seeking various policy solutions to help small business owners maintain stable operations.


Lee Kisung, President of the Gwangju Small Business Association, stated, "Chairman Jeon Seungil is an exemplary legislative leader who respects local small business owners not simply as recipients of support but as key players in the regional economy, and has reflected the voices from the field in policy. We decided to present this plaque in appreciation of his dedication and efforts."


Chairman Jeon Seungil said, "I believe this plaque is not an honor given to an individual, but the result of efforts made together with local small business owners. I will continue to listen closely to voices from the field and do my utmost to ensure that small business owners are respected and that Seo-gu becomes a district where the regional economy thrives."


He added, "Local small business owners are the roots of Seo-gu's economy and the most important pillars supporting our community. Going forward, I will continue to work alongside small business owners not only as the chairman of the council but also as a member of the community, taking responsibility to find solutions on the ground."
